#c830da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c830da is composed of 78.4% red, 18.8% green and 85.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 8.3% cyan, 78%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.5% black. It has a hue angle of 293.6 degrees, a saturation of 69.7% and a lightness of 52.2%. #c830da color hex could be obtained by blending #ff60ff with #9100b5. Closest websafe color is: #cc33cc.

#c830da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#c830da has RGB values of R:200, G:48, B:218 and CMYK values of C:0.08, M:0.78, Y:0,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 13119706.

Shades and Tints of #c830da

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090209 is the darkest color, while #fdf8fe is the lightest one.
